New grants from the Séneca Foundation to hire doctors, technologists, and young people with vocational training
Por FactBox Admin

The Regional Ministry of Environment, Industry, Universities, Research and Mar Menor has approved an Order establishing the regulatory bases for the grants from the Séneca Foundation-Science and Technology Agency of the Region of Murcia for the hiring of early-career doctors, technologists, and R&D&i managers, as well as young people with Higher Vocational Training qualifications. The grants are co-financed by the European Social Fund Plus (ESF+) within the Region of Murcia ESF+ Program 2021-2027. The regulation is published in the Official Gazette of the Region of Murcia number 208, dated September 9, 2026, with reference NPE A-090926-4306.
The Order, signed in Murcia on September 2, 2026, by the Regional Minister Juan María Vázquez Rojas, responds to the exclusive competence of the Autonomous Community regarding the promotion of scientific research. The Séneca Foundation, a regional public sector entity, was generically authorized to grant subsidies through the Order of July 15, 2016, and is functionally dependent on this Ministry. The bases have been developed under the special non-competitive concurrence regime provided for in Article 22 of Law 7/2005, of November 18, on Subsidies of the Region of Murcia, and are integrated into the Strategic Plan of the Region of Murcia 2022-2027.
Three hiring modalities
The bases regulate three grant programs, each with its own subsidy modality:
- Modality A (measure 1.A.7.1): employment contracting of unemployed early-career doctors, including the long-term unemployed.
- Modality B (measure 1.A.7.2): hiring of unemployed early-career technologists and R&D&i managers.
- Modality C (measure 1.A.8.3): hiring of unemployed young people, up to 35 years of age, with a Higher Vocational Training qualification.
Personnel are considered “early-career” if they have not previously performed the same functions at the destination center that they will develop under these bases, a fact that must be certified by the requesting organization.
Beneficiaries and financing
Beneficiaries may include companies, technology centers, private R&D entities, universities, and public research organizations and centers based in the Region of Murcia. Companies must have an R&D&i department or a research track record. The grants may have co-financing of 60% from the ESF+, and the subsidy will finance 85% of the unit cost for the hiring of men and 90% for women, in full-time contracts. The maximum completion date for the hirings is December 31, 2028.
Processing and deadlines
The procedure will be initiated ex officio through a call for applications approved by the Presidency of the Séneca Foundation, which will be published in full in the National Grants Database (BDNS) and in summary in the BORM. Applications shall be submitted electronically via the Foundation’s electronic office (www.fseneca.es), within a period of no less than 15 business days from its publication in the BDNS, and will be processed in order of receipt.
